Factors to Consider When Choosing Rv Lithium Battery Combiner Box
Selecting the right RV lithium battery combiner box depends on your system size, whether you prioritize automation or manual control, and your environment. The key is finding a solution that balances safety, ease of installation, and system compatibility. For solar setups, weather resistance and surge protection are vital, while for simple battery management, safety and straightforward operation might be enough.
Understanding Your System Needs
Before choosing a combiner box, consider your system voltage, battery type, and whether you want manual or automatic operation. Larger solar arrays benefit from weather-resistant, high-current boxes, while smaller RV systems may only need basic isolation managers. Think about future expansion and whether integrated diagnostics or remote monitoring are important for your setup.
Key Features to Consider
Safety features like overvoltage and overtemperature protection are essential, especially in lithium systems. Ease of installation, whether pre-wired or requiring wiring expertise, impacts setup time. Compatibility with your existing batteries and inverter systems ensures seamless operation. For outdoor use, weatherproof enclosures and surge protection are non-negotiable.
Manual vs. Automatic Systems
Manual systems, like push-button switches, offer simple control and are often more affordable but demand user intervention during emergencies. Automatic systems, such as intelligent combiners, provide continuous protection and system optimization but require correct setup and some technical knowledge. Your choice should reflect your comfort with electrical systems and your need for convenience or control.
Frequently Asked Questions
What is the main difference between a combiner box and a battery isolator?
A combiner box typically consolidates multiple battery connections into a single or dual output, providing organization, safety, and protection, especially in solar setups. An isolator primarily prevents batteries from discharging or overcharging, focusing on safety rather than system organization. The choice depends on whether you need system management or just basic safety isolation.
Are all lithium battery combiner boxes compatible with RV systems?
Not all boxes are designed specifically for RV use; many are optimized for solar or off-grid applications. When selecting a combiner box, ensure it supports your system voltage, current ratings, and battery chemistry. For RV setups, look for models with suitable ratings, ease of wiring, and outdoor durability if exposed to the elements.
Can I install a lithium battery combiner box myself?
Installation difficulty varies. Basic models like simple isolators are straightforward for those with basic electrical knowledge. More advanced or outdoor solar combiner boxes may require professional wiring and safety considerations. Always follow manufacturer instructions and local electrical codes to ensure safe operation.
What safety features should I look for in a lithium battery combiner box?
Look for overvoltage, overtemperature, and short-circuit protection, which prevent damage to batteries and system components. Transient voltage suppression and surge protection add further safety, especially in outdoor or solar environments. These features help avoid costly failures and extend system lifespan.
Is a smart or automatic combiner better for RV use?
Automatic or smart combiners like the Victron Cyrix-Li-ct provide ongoing system protection through automatic disconnection during unsafe conditions, reducing user intervention. They are ideal for users wanting continuous safety and system monitoring, though they may involve higher initial setup complexity. Manual switches are simpler but require active management.
